INDIVIDUAL MCP TOOL

portal_evm_get_ohlc

Build chart-ready EVM OHLC candles plus a recent trade tape from supported DEX event sources, including Uniswap v2-style swaps, Uniswap v3/v4, and Aerodrome Slipstream.
